Find Where Increasing/Decreasing Using Derivatives f(x)=x/(x^2+1)
Problem
Solution
Find the derivative of the function using the quotient rule, where
u=x andv=x2+1
Simplify the numerator to find the expression for the first derivative.
Identify critical points by setting the derivative equal to zero and solving for
x
Determine the sign of the derivative in the intervals created by the critical points:
(−∞,−1) (−1,1) and(1,∞)
Conclude the intervals based on the sign of the derivative. The function is increasing where
ƒ(x)′>0 and decreasing whereƒ(x)′<0
